No way. He was very poor against Panama, although he had that magical assist to Lukaku which made people forget about it. In the group stages in general he was pretty average although he was playing out of position. Today again he was very poor, but you could see the quality he possesses with that insane ball to Lukaku
He is a victim of his versatility because when he's playing in an unfamiliar position, he produces 60/70% of his ability. In the group stages and qualifiers I thought he wasn't close enough to opposition to cause them much problems. Against France he was playing out of position but against Brazil he was a different animal. That's De Bruyne for you. In hindsight maybe Martinez should have used Carrasco and ChadlI as wing backs and allowed Witsel and Fellaini hold whilst playing KDB off Lukaku.
